Understanding Types of Car Keys
Before diving into the replacement process, it is vital to comprehend the different car key types offered:
Car Key TypeDescriptionReplacement ComplexityCost RangeConventional KeyFundamental, metal keys without electronic functions.Low₤ 5 - ₤ 30Transponder KeyKeys with embedded chips that interact with the vehicle.Moderate₤ 50 - ₤ 150Key Fob/ Smart KeyAdvanced keys that permit keyless entry and start functions, often geared up with remotes.High₤ 150 - ₤ 500Valet KeyA simplified version of a key that permits limited access to the vehicle.Moderate₤ 50 - ₤ 100Aspects to Consider When Replacing Lost Car Keys
When faced with the unfortunate circumstance of losing car keys, several factors will influence the replacement procedure:
Type of Key: The more advanced the key (such as fobs or transponder keys), the more complicated and costly the replacement might be.
Vehicle Make and Model: Replacement costs and techniques can differ considerably based upon the car's brand, model, and year.
Availability of Spare Keys: If a spare key exists, duplication can be a more straightforward and less expensive alternative.

Expense: The variety of expenses for key replacement can be significant, with some methods proving to be more economical than others.
Approaches for Replacing Lost Car Keys
There are numerous techniques one can pursue in changing lost car keys, from DIY solutions to expert services.
1. Expert Locksmith Services
An expert locksmith professional can offer a quick and often more economical solution for replacing lost keys. They typically provide the following services:
Key Duplication: If a spare key is readily available, a locksmith professional can quickly replicate it.Reprogramming: For keys that have transponder functions, locksmith professionals can typically reprogram existing keys and fobs.Cutting New Keys: A locksmith professional can develop a brand-new key from the vehicle's lock, admitted is available.2. Car Dealerships
Checking out a car dealer is another typical choice for key replacement, especially for innovative keys.
Factory Replacement: Dealerships have access to manufacturer-specific key codes, allowing them to make a precise replica.More Expensive: This approach is normally the most costly but might be essential for particular makes or models.3. DIY Solutions
For people comfy handling a difficulty, some DIY techniques might work depending on the situation.
Key Programming Kits: Some online resources and kits allow owners to program spare keys themselves, particularly for particular models.Short-term Solutions: In emergencies, producing makeshift keys or hot-wiring might work for older models however is usually not suggested due to legality and damage risks.4. Insurance coverage Options
Some auto insurance plan cover key replacement or loss. For that reason, evaluating one's policy could reveal if monetary assistance is available for this trouble.
5. Mobile Key Replacement Services
With the introduction of technology, mobile locksmith professional services can come to your location to provide key replacement. They might use:
Convenience: No requirement to tow the vehicle or leave home.Quick Service: Many can cut and configure new keys on-site.Preventive Measures to Avoid Lost Car Keys
Taking a number of simple preventative actions can assist minimize the threat of losing car keys in the future:
Designate a Specific Spot: Establish a practice of putting keys in the exact same area every time.
Keychain Tracking Devices: Utilize Bluetooth trackers, such as Tile or Apple AirTags, which can help in finding lost keys.
Spare Copies: Have at least one spare key easily accessible, either with relied on household members or saved safely.
Frequently Asked Questions about Lost Car Keys Replacement1. How much does it normally cost to replace lost car keys?
The cost of changing lost car keys can differ widely based on the type of key and where you have it replaced. Standard keys can vary from ₤ 5 to ₤ 30, while clever keys can cost upwards of ₤ 150 to ₤ 500.
2. Can I replace my lost car key without a spare?
Yes, you can replace a lost car key without a spare. An expert locksmith or dealer can produce a brand-new key by accessing your vehicle's lock or utilizing the vehicle recognition number (VIN).
3. How long does it take to replace lost car keys?
Replacement times can differ by technique. A locksmith professional may need just 15-- 30 minutes, while dealerships might take longer, particularly if they require to buy particular keys.
4. Exist any legal factors to consider if I lost my car keys?
No specific legal problems develop from losing keys. However, if somebody discovers your lost keys, they could possibly access your car, calling for careful practices concerning personal security.
5. What if my keys are taken?
If your keys are stolen, it's necessary to take immediate action. Besides changing your keys, consider changing your locks or using a locksmith professional to reprogram your transponder keys to prevent unapproved access.
